Historical Weather Data

Florence typically experiences warm and sunny summers with average high temperatures ranging from 28°C to 32°C (82°F to 90°F) in July and August. Winters are mild, with average temperatures between 5°C and 10°C (41°F and 50°F) in December and January. Rainfall is fairly consistent throughout the year, with slightly higher amounts in the spring and autumn. According to historical data from the National Weather Service, Florence sees an average of 90 days of rain per year.

Best Time to Visit Florence

The best time to visit Florence is during the sp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October). During these months, the weather is mild and pleasant, making it ideal for sightseeing and outdoor activities. The temperatures are comfortable, and there are fewer crowds compared to the peak summer months. Additionally, the shoulder seasons offer vibrant cultural events and festivals.

Key Attractions and Weather Considerations

  • Uffizi Gallery: Plan to visit early in the morning to avoid crowds and the heat, especially during the summer months.
  • Duomo (Florence Cathedral): Climbing the Duomo can be strenuous, so check the weather forecast and avoid going during extremely hot or rainy days.
  • Ponte Vecchio: This iconic bridge is beautiful in any weather, but it’s particularly lovely during a sunny evening.
  • Boboli Gardens: Enjoy a leisurely stroll in these gardens on a pleasant day. Check the forecast for rain or excessive heat before visiting.

FAQ Section

What is the average temperature in Florence in July?

The average high temperature in Florence in July is around 31°C (88°F), and the average low is about 19°C (66°F).

How much does it rain in Florence?

What is the best month to visit Florence for good weather?

The best months to visit Florence for good weather are April, May, September, and October. These months offer mild temperatures and fewer crowds.

What should I wear in Florence in October?

In October, it's best to wear layers. Pack a light jacket or sweater, comfortable walking shoes, and an umbrella, as there is a chance of rain.
